Concerts in Spain Comemmorate Armenian Genocide

MADRID (Armradio.am) — The State Youth Orchestra of Armenia, under the baton of maestro Sergey Smbatyan, performed on the same stage with world-renowned violinist Ara Malikian, who was nominated for “Latin Grammy.”

The concerts took place on September 25, in “Mozart” Concert Hall in Zaragoza, and on September 26 in Royal Theatre of Madrid.

Works by Khachaturian, Mendelssohn, Paganini, Tchaikovsky and others, works from “Led Zeppelin” repertoire were performed. M Ara Malikian’s “1915”, dedicated to the victims of the Armenian Genocide, specially written for these concerts, was also presented.

Artistic Director and Principal Conductor of the State Youth Orchestra of Armenia Sergey Smbatyan said it was interesting for the Orchestra and for himself to work with a unique musician like Ara Malikian.

Ara Malikian was born in Beirut, studied in London and lives in Madrid. He is a virtuoso violinist with bright expressiveness, an author of a dozen albums. The sound of his violin is the most original and innovative in the contemporary music world. Malikian participates in numerous prestigious international competitions, performing more than 450 concerts in 40 countries around the world every year.

Sergey Smbatyan noted also that in 2016 they will try to invite Ara Malikian to Armenia. “We are always looking for Armenians in other nations but we forget that we have real Armenian heroes that affect the formation of the image of Armenia abroad,” Smbatyan added.
